Castle Boutique 3.37

4.2 star(s) from 28 votes
Phoenix, AZ 85051
United States

About Castle Boutique

Castle Boutique Castle Boutique is one of the popular place listed under Clothing Store in Phoenix , Grocery Store in Phoenix ,

Contact Details & Working Hours

Map of Castle Boutique

Reviews of Castle Boutique

   Loading comments-box...